3.  Rated Torque and Rated Power of the Motor 
When holding pressure is under maximum pressure, the required torque cannot exceed 
1.5 times of the motor’s rated torque (depending on the data provided by the motor’s 
manufacturer) at most or the motor would be overheated. Let us take the factor 1.5 as an 
example, if the rated torque of the motor is 77 N-m, the motor with a power of 12kW* and 
a rated speed of 1500 rpm can be chosen.

4.  Maximum Current of the Motor 
Example: Check the parameter kt (Torque/A) in the motor’s specifications fist. If kt = 3.37, 
the maximum current is approximately 116/3.37 = 34A at the maximum torque 
of 116 N-m.

  Before running the hybrid servo drive, verify if there’s enough cooling oil in the oil circulation. 
You need to preheat the cooling medium such as cooling oil to prevent any condensation caused 
by temperature differences. 
 
  Make sure that the cooling medium stay liquidized to keep the heat dissipating system stays 
functional. So do follow the oil temperature limitation (10 ~ 50 ºC), (50 ºF ~ 122 ºF) to prevent 
overheating on cooling oil. 
 
  Heat dissipating system:    The maximum working pressure cannot go over 1.5 bar at the oil 
inlet. Do not exchange the positions of oil inlet and oil outlet. Verify the specification of 
connector’s pope thread (1/2” PT) to prevent damaging the pipe thread. Wrap pipe threads with 
teflon tape (thread seal tape).
